CWinApp::AddDocTemplate

void AddDocTemplate( CDocTemplate* pTemplate );

参数:
pTemplate指向要增加的CDocTemplate的指针。

说明:

调用这个成员函数,将文档模板加入应用程序维护的可用文档模板列表中。你可以在调用RegisterShellFileTypes之前加入所有的文档模板。

示例:

BOOL CMyApp::InitInstance()
{
  // ...
  // 下面的代码是在你选择MDI(多文档界面)选项时AppWizard为你生成的。
  CMultiDocTemplate* pDocTemplate;
  pDocTemplate = new CMultiDocTemplate(
      IDR_MYTYPE,
      RUNTIME_CLASS(CMyDoc),
      RUNTIME_CLASS(CMDIChildWnd), // 标准的MDI子框架
      RUNTIME_CLASS(CMyView)
     );

  AddDocTemplate(pDocTemplate);
  // ...
}

请参阅:
CWinApp::RegisterShellFileTypes, CMultiDocTemplate, CSingleDocTemplate